git 我在本地的Frappe应用程序中做了一些更改,之后,我接受了它从visual studio代码,因为我已经克隆它在我的系统

9nvpjoqh  于 2023-09-29  发布在  Git
关注(0)|答案(1)|浏览(77)

我在我的frappe应用程序中做了一些本地更改。
在那之后,我接受了它从Visual Studio代码,因为我已经克隆它在我的系统上。
之后,我打开我的Linux终端,通过git status查看状态,它显示了我所做的更改。
然后,我输入了git commit -m“my changes”
最后,我通过git push upstream new_分支将它推送到主服务器。
但现在,我只有阅读权限,所以我不能这样做。
所以我的问题是当我获得主项目的写权限时,我是否需要再次执行此过程?
或者我可以再按一次吗?
因为现在当我输入git status时,它显示没有什么可提交的。

lzfw57am

lzfw57am1#

一个简单的推就足够了。
获得远程存储库的写访问权限不会改变您的本地克隆和本地工作。
注意:一般不会直接推送到upstream,只会推送到默认的远程' origin ',它应该指向您自己的仓库(或仓库的分支)。
一旦push,您就可以启动一个pull request,并将原始上游存储库的一个分支作为目标。

相关问题